About this book
It is 1940 and Kenneth Lockwood is a Lieutenant in the British colonial armed forces, stationed in Southern Nigeria. When World War II breaks out, he and his men are deployed as reinforcements to halt the Italian aggression in East Africa. On the treacherous march to the Eastern front, Kenneth will come face to face with the horrors of colonization and war, examine the bitter fruit of his own family legacy, grapple with questions of his place and purpose, and confront a stalking, terrifying creature known by the locals as The Ngoloko.
